Isaiah 41:24

WEB

24Behold, you are nothing, and your work is nothing. He who chooses you is an abomination.

KJV

24Behold, ye are of nothing, and your work of nought: an abomination is he that chooseth you.

BSB

24Behold, you are nothing and your work is of no value. Anyone who chooses you is detestable.

FBV

24But look at you! You're nothing, and you can't do anything! Anyone who chooses you is disgusting!
